Pune is a sprawling city in the western Indian state of Maharashtra. It was once the base of the Peshwas (prime ministers) of the Maratha Empire, which lasted from 1674 to 1818. It’s known for the grand Aga Khan Palace, built in 1892 and now a memorial to Mahatma Gandhi, whose ashes are preserved in the garden. The 8th-century Pataleshwar Cave Temple is dedicated to the Hindu god Shiva.
What is Pune famous for?
Historical landmarks include the Lal Mahal, the Kasba Ganapati temple and Shaniwar Wada. Major historical events involving the city include the Mughal–Maratha Wars and the Anglo-Maratha Wars. Pune is the largest IT hub in India. It is also the most important automobile and manufacturing hub of India.
What is the special place in Pune?
Lal Mahal is one of the famous tourist places in Pune which has another name as Red Palace. It is a beautiful monument established in 1630 AD by Shivaji Maharaj’s father Shahaji Bhosale for his wife and son. Shivaji Maharaj lived here for a long time until the time he captured his first fort.

How long does it take to fly from Delhi to Pune?
A direct flight usually takes 2 hours 15 minutes on this route. It is suggested to book your flights two weeks before to avail the cheap Delhi to Pune flight ticket. Jet Airways, JetLite, Air India, IndiGo, SpiceJet, Airasia India, and Vistara Airlines have direct flights on this route.

What type of city is Pune?
The cultural capital of India, Pune is often described as the “Oxford of the East” due to the presence of several prestigious educational institutions and research centers. The city has become a major education hub in the country.
What is unique in Pune?

The Maratha culture is extremely prominent in Pune, more than any other place in Maharashtra. This culture permeates through the blood of Punekars as they celebrate festivals like Sankranti, Gudi Padwa, Ganesh Chaturthi, and Shivratri with pomp all year round.

What is Pune popularly called?
“Vishaya“ means land and “Punaka“ and “Punya“ mean holy. Noted history scholar Pandurang Balkawade said the city was known as “Kasbe Pune“ when in the command of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j’s father, Shahaji Raje BhosaleIt became “Poona“ in the British regime in 1857 and was last changed to Pune in 1978.

Why is Pune called a student city?

The City is regarded as the Oxford of the east because of the numerous educational institutes under the 9 well established universities. Apart from professional courses, Pune also offers diverse undergraduate courses that are not limited to the three main streams of arts, science and commerce.

Is Pune is a metro city?

Pune Metropolitan Region (PMR) is the metropolitan region around the city of Pune. According to practical purposes, PMR comprises two Municipal Corporations of PMC, PCMC and three Cantonment Boards, spread over an area of 7,256.46 km2. The population of the region as per 2011 census was 7,541,946.
What type of climate does Pune have?
Pune has a hot semi-arid climate (BSh) bordering with tropical wet and dry (Aw) with average temperatures ranging between 19 to 33 °C (66 to 91 °F). Pune experiences three seasons: summer, monsoon, and winter.
